Colombia Denies Cooperation
- Colombian Interior Minister Armando Benedetti denied military cooperation with Venezuela amid U.S. warship deployments.
- President Gustavo Petro criticized potential U.S. military actions, alleging they target Venezuela's resources.
- White House press secretary Karoline Leavitt stated the Trump administration is prepared to use all American power against Venezuela, calling Maduro's regime a "narco terror cartel."
- Maduro condemned U.S. threats, asserting Venezuela will mobilize militia to defend its sovereignty.
